Wound dehiscence is where a wound fails to heal, often re-opening a few days after surgery (most common in abdominal surgery). It can be divided into two clinical entities: Superficial dehiscence – the skin wound alone fails, with the rectus sheath remaining intact. Often occurs secondary to local infection, poorly controlled ...

Living in Fawn … WebMay 12, 2016 · Prosthetic valve dehiscence (PVD) affects 0.1–1.3 % of patients undergoing aortic valve replacement [ 1 ]. Of its many causes, when valve dehiscence is consequent to infective endocarditis, the mortality of this life-threatening situation is compounded.
